Indian Cricket Team's Test Squad for England Series Expanded: New Player Added, According to Reports.

Recent reports suggest a minor alteration to India's squad for the highly anticipated Test series against England, with the team strength purportedly increasing from the initially announced 18 to 19 members. While the BCCI is yet to issue an official confirmation, sources indicate that the additional player is none other than right-arm fast bowler Harshit Rana.

The initial 18-member squad, revealed on May 24, 2025, already showcased a blend of experience and fresh talent under the leadership of Shubman Gill, who was named captain following Rohit Sharma's retirement from Test cricket. Rishabh Pant was appointed as his deputy. The squad features a mix of established players and promising newcomers, reflecting a strategic approach to build a formidable team for the challenging English conditions. Key inclusions in the original squad were the comeback of Karun Nair, Sai Sudharsan's maiden Test call-up, and the return of Shardul Thakur.

If the reports regarding Harshit Rana's inclusion are accurate, it would further bolster India's pace attack, which already boasts a formidable lineup of Jasprit Bumrah, Mohammed Siraj, Prasidh Krishna, Akash Deep, and Arshdeep Singh. Rana's potential addition would provide further depth and variety to the bowling options available to captain Shubman Gill.

Harshit Rana, a young and promising fast bowler, has been making waves in domestic cricket with his impressive performances. His ability to generate pace and extract bounce makes him a potentially valuable asset in English conditions, known for favoring seam and swing bowlers. Sources suggest that Rana was initially part of the India 'A' team touring England and his elevation to the Test squad indicates the team management's confidence in his abilities.

The decision to potentially include Rana could be influenced by a couple of factors. Firstly, the need to manage the workload of senior bowlers like Jasprit Bumrah, who is returning from an injury layoff. Ajit Agarkar, Chairman of the BCCI's selection committee, has already indicated that Bumrah may not be available for all five Tests. Secondly, the English weather and the demanding schedule of five Test matches within a relatively short span require a strong and varied pace attack to maintain pressure on the opposition.

The five-match Test series against England is scheduled to commence on June 20th in Leeds, followed by matches in Birmingham, London (Lord's), Manchester, and The Oval (London). This series marks the beginning of the new ICC World Test Championship cycle, adding significance to each match.

India's Test Squad: Shubman Gill (C), Rishabh Pant (VC & WK), Yashasvi Jaiswal, KL Rahul, Sai Sudharsan, Abhimanyu Easwaran, Karun Nair, Nitish Reddy, Ravindra Jadeja, Dhruv Jurel (WK), Washington Sundar, Shardul Thakur, Jasprit Bumrah, Mohd. Siraj, Prasidh Krishna, Akash Deep, Arshdeep Singh, Kuldeep Yadav and Harshit Rana (Unconfirmed).
